    Has anyone found a substitute oil pressure gage and sending unit to replace the standard units on the 308's. I ues SW sending units when I do Jag V8 conversions but it is a 100psi sending unit. SW makes a more stable unit unlike the stock unit. What do the race guys use? Also if I want to install a gage in the oil filter unit what is the thread size and do they make an adapter I can buy that allows me to hook up a pressure gage and a sending unit. Thanks

    Thread size varies. Mine was 12mm, but had a little 'adapter' that had to come out, as you can no longer get a 12mm sender. 18mm fit the hole w/o the adapter. The other size used is 20mm.
